10 Encouraging Verses from Philippians

Do you have a favorite book of the Bible? I have to admit, my favorite is usually the one I am studying. 🙂 But, truth be told, I almost always come back to Philippians when I need encouragement.

Here are a few of the most encouraging verses from Philippians.

10 encouraging verses from Philippians

And I am sure of this, that he who began a good work in you will bring it to completion at the day of Jesus Christ. Philippians 1:6

I don’t know about you, but sometimes I feel like the biggest mess in the world.  It’s such a hope-filled promise that I am not finished yet but one day He will finish what He has begun in me.

And it is my prayer that your love may abound more and more, with knowledge and all discernment, so that you may approve what is excellent, and so be pure and blameless for the day of Christ. Philippians 1:9-10

It’s the way we love others and love the Lord that shows what He is doing in us. Keep loving those people around you, keep giving more of yourself to Him — let your love grow and grow!

Only let your manner of life be worthy of the gospel of Christ, so that whether I come and see you or am absent, I may hear of you that you are standing firm in one spirit, with one mind striving side by side for the faith of the gospel. Philippians 1:27

It is one of my greatest desires to stand firm and to be passionate about the Gospel. Paul’s reminder of the value of standing firm together within the church is a reminder we are not called to do this on our own.

Do nothing from selfish ambition or conceit, but in humility count others more significant than yourselves. Philippians 2:3

Humility … learning to count others as more significant than ourselves. What an awesome challenge to all of us.

Therefore, my beloved, as you have always obeyed, so now, not only as in my presence but much more in my absence, work out your own salvation with fear and trembling. Philippians 2:12

Sometimes this working out of our salvation is hard. I’ve done a lot of fear and trembling as I sought the Lord’s direction for my life. But it is good work, a good process through which we know Him more.

Do all things without grumbling or disputing. Philippians 2:14

No grumbling! When I start thinking how frustrated I am with someone or with a situation, this verse reminds me of the value of kind words and a servant heart.

Indeed, I count everything as loss because of the surpassing worth of knowing Christ Jesus my Lord. For his sake I have suffered the loss of all things and count them as rubbish, in order that I may gain Christ. Philippians 3:8

May I count EVERYTHING as loss compared to the SURPASSING worth of KNOWING Christ!!

But our citizenship is in heaven, and from it we await a Savior, the Lord Jesus Christ. Philippians 3:20

This world is not our home. All the heartbreak, the hurting, the sorrow, the tears … it will all one day end!

And the peace of God, which surpasses all understanding, will guard your hearts and your minds in Christ Jesus. Philippians 4:7

When the days are chaotic and the news is full of turmoil and life is spinning out of control, there is a peace in knowing Christ.

The grace of the Lord Jesus Christ be with your spirit. Philippians 4:23

One of my favorite benedictions.
